Results in Dedham, Peabody, Hanover, Lexington and Billerica

Showing 3 of 33 results
Be U Nails and Spa
97 Massachusetts Ave, Lexington, MA , Lexington, Massachusetts 02420, United States
Be U Nails and Spa
Em Nails and Spa
297 Lynn St, Peabody, MA , Peabody, Massachusetts 01960, United States
Em Nails and Spa
Lovely Nails & Spa Dedham
527 Providence Hwy, Dedham, MA , Dedham, Massachusetts 02026, United States
Lovely Nails & Spa Dedham
1 2 3 4

Download our App